Is Illinois Fertility Treatment Covered by Insurance?
One of the most common concerns for individuals seeking fertility treatment is cost. Fortunately, Illinois is one of the few states with laws mandating insurance coverage for infertility diagnosis and treatment. Under the Illinois Insurance Code, certain plans must cover up to four cycles of IVF for eligible individuals.

However, it’s important to note that not all insurance plans are subject to these requirements. For example, self-insured plans and some employer-sponsored plans may be exempt. To understand your coverage, review your policy details or consult with your insurance provider. Additionally, many clinics offer financing options or payment plans to make Illinois fertility treatment more accessible.
What Are the Common Types of Fertility Treatments Available in Illinois?
Illinois fertility clinics offer a wide range of treatments designed to address various causes of infertility. Some of the most common options include:
- In Vitro Fertilization (IVF): A process where eggs are retrieved from the ovaries and fertilized in a lab before being transferred to the uterus.
- Intrauterine Insemination (IUI): A procedure where sperm is directly inserted into the uterus during ovulation.
- Ovulation Induction: The use of medications to stimulate egg production in women who do not ovulate regularly.
- Egg Freezing: A method of preserving eggs for future use, often chosen by women who wish to delay parenthood.
Each treatment has its own benefits and considerations, so it’s essential to discuss your options with a fertility specialist.

The Role of Technology in Illinois Fertility Treatment
Advancements in technology have revolutionized Illinois fertility treatment, making it more effective and accessible than ever before. Techniques like preimplantation genetic testing (PGT) allow doctors to screen embryos for genetic abnormalities, increasing the chances of a successful pregnancy. Additionally, innovations in cryopreservation have improved the safety and viability of frozen eggs, sperm, and embryos.
Telemedicine is another technological advancement that has transformed fertility care in Illinois. Many clinics now offer virtual consultations, making it easier for patients to connect with specialists without traveling long distances. This is particularly beneficial for individuals living in rural areas or those with busy schedules.

Understanding the Costs of Fertility Treatment in Illinois
The cost of Illinois fertility treatment can vary depending on the type of procedure, the clinic, and individual circumstances. On average, IVF cycles can range from $12,000 to $15,000, while IUI may cost between $300 and $1,000 per cycle. Additional expenses, such as medications and genetic testing, can also add to the overall cost.
To manage expenses, explore financial assistance programs offered by clinics or nonprofit organizations. Some clinics provide discounts for military personnel, first responders, or individuals undergoing multiple treatment cycles.

What is the average success rate for IVF in Illinois?
The success rate for IVF in Illinois varies based on factors like age and the specific clinic. However, national averages indicate a success rate of approximately 40-50% for women under 35.
How long does a typical fertility treatment cycle take?
A standard IVF cycle typically takes about 4-6 weeks from start to finish, including preparation, egg retrieval, and embryo transfer.
Are there age limits for Illinois fertility treatment?
While there are no strict age limits, success rates tend to decline with age. Most clinics recommend pursuing treatment before the age of 45 for optimal outcomes.
Can single individuals or LGBTQ+ couples access fertility treatment in Illinois?
Yes, Illinois fertility clinics welcome patients from all backgrounds, including single individuals and LGBTQ+ couples. Many clinics offer tailored services such as donor eggs, donor sperm, and surrogacy options.
